New keyword vs Override Keyword [Resolved]

Posted by Narla.Venkatesh under C# on 11/6/2012 | Points: 10 | Views : 1595 | Status : [Member] | Replies : 1
Can any please share the difference between New and Override in C#



Posted by: Saratvaddilli on: 11/6/2012 [Member] [MVP] Bronze | Points: 50



The new modifier instructs the compiler to use your child class implementation instead of the parent class implementation. Any code that is not referencing your class but the parent class will use the parent class implementation.

The override modifier may be used on virtual methods and must be used on abstract methods. This indicates for the compiler to use the last defined implementation of a method. Even if the method is called on a reference to the base class it will use the implementation overriding it.
go through these links you may have better idea

Thanks and Regards
Show difficulties that how difficult you are

Narla.Venkatesh, if this helps please login to Mark As Answer. | Alert Moderator

Login to post response